Output 65db721c383d9ff1228db6b46ca540b07fd8c774544824e176cc10b6dfdba87a:57

value
759546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e8ac34bb1945190050c68430318e9ce1a4e7e2 OP_EQUAL
address
36WmnuAHw1ZfZWmNv8nKvYLGrJKPvgTDcZ
transaction
65db721c383d9ff1228db6b46ca540b07fd8c774544824e176cc10b6dfdba87a
confirmations
231235
spent
true